Have look at the ACS712 current monitor modules they measure both AC and DC currents. They are available in a range of current measurements, two I know of are a 5Amp module and a 30 Amp module. These can easily be linked to an Arduino and if you have a LCD display or 7 Segment display the measured current can easily be displayed. The ACS 712 modules are widely available, cheaply from China. Google "ACS 712 and Arduino", that will bring up a load of information to get you going.
If you are working with voltages like 110 VAC or 230 VAC PLEASE ensure you fully understand the dangers of these voltages and that you are competent to work with them.
